Engineers India Limited Begins Construction of 5 TPD Compressed Biogas Plant in Kolhapur, Maharashtra

EIL’s Self-Funded CBG Project to Process 125 TPD Press Mud, Promote Renewable Fuels, Sustainable Agriculture, and Support India’s Waste-to-Energy Goals

Kolhapur: Engineers India Limited (EIL) has commenced site activities for its Compressed Biogas (CBG) Plant at the MIDC Halkarni Industrial Area in Kolhapur district, Maharashtra. The foundation stone laying ceremony was presided over by Mr. Pankaj Jain, Secretary, Ministry of Petroleum & Natural Gas, in the presence of Ms. Vartika Shukla, C&MD of EIL, board directors, and senior officials of the company.

Project Overview and Capacity

The CBG plant, a self-funded initiative by EIL, is designed to produce 5 tonnes per day (TPD) of Compressed Biogas. The plant will process approximately 125 TPD of press mud, sourced directly from sugar mills and through aggregators, using bio-methanation (anaerobic digestion) technology.

The CBG produced at the plant will be supplied to Hindustan Petroleum Corporation Ltd. (HPCL) and made available for vehicular applications through HPCL retail outlets. This initiative is expected to contribute to reduced carbon emissions and promote the use of renewable fuels in the transport sector.

Sustainable By-products and Circular Economy

In addition to clean gaseous fuel, the project will generate Fermented Organic Manure (FOM) and Liquid Fermented Organic Manure (LFOM) as by-products. These products will support sustainable agricultural practices and contribute to a circular economy, providing farmers with eco-friendly fertilizers while reducing waste.

Strategic Importance and Alignment with National Initiatives

The project reflects EIL’s strategic intent to expand its footprint in sustainable energy infrastructure, complementing its core engineering capabilities. The initiative is aligned with national programs such as SATAT (Sustainable Alternative Towards Affordable Transportation), Atmanirbhar Bharat, and India’s long-term energy transition goals.

By contributing to India’s Waste-to-Energy and Clean Mobility Ecosystem, the project demonstrates EIL’s commitment to driving innovation in the renewable energy sector while supporting environmental sustainability and national energy objectives.

About Engineers India Limited

Engineers India Limited (EIL) is a premier Public Sector Undertaking (PSU) engineering consultancy and project management company under the Ministry of Petroleum & Natural Gas. With expertise spanning oil & gas, petrochemicals, refineries, renewable energy, and infrastructure projects, EIL has been instrumental in delivering innovative, sustainable, and high-quality engineering solutions across India and globally.
